Update the Vital Product Data (VPD)
Use this topic to update the Vital Product Data (VPD).
(Required) Machine type
(Required) Serial number
(Required) System model
(Optional) Asset tag
(Optional) UUID
Recommended tools:
Lenovo XClarity Provisioning Manager
Lenovo XClarity Essentials OneCLI commands
Using Lenovo XClarity Provisioning Manager
Steps:
1. Start the server and press the key according to the on-screen instructions. The Lenovo XClarity
Provisioning Manager interface is displayed by default.
2. Click
on the top right corner of the Lenovo XClarity Provisioning Manager main interface.
3. Click Update VPD; then, follow on-screen instructions to update the VPD.
Using Lenovo XClarity Essentials OneCLI commands
Updating machine type
onecli config set VPD.SysInfoProdName10 <m/t_model> [access_method]
Updating serial number
onecli config set VPD.SysInfoSerialNum10 <s/n> [access_method]
Updating system model
onecli config set VPD.SysInfoProdIdentifier <system model> [access_method]
Updating asset tag
onecli config set VPD.SysEncloseAssetTag <asset_tag> [access_method]
Updating UUID
onecli config createuuid VPD.SysInfoUUID [access_method]
Variable
Description
<m/t_model>
The server machine type and model number.
Type xxxxyyy, where xxxx is the machine type and yyy is the server model number.
<s/n>
The serial number on the server.
Type zzzzzzz, where zzzzzzz is the serial number.
<system model>
The system model on the server.
Type system yyyyyyyy, where yyyyyyyy is the product identifier.
